Enhancing Mobile App Performance for Better UX

Chosen theme: Enhancing Mobile App Performance for Better UX. Welcome! This home page is your friendly hub for building lightning-fast experiences that feel effortless. Together, we’ll turn milliseconds into smiles—subscribe, comment, and share your toughest performance questions.

Emotion Behind Every Millisecond
A fast response says, “we value your time.” A slow one quietly apologizes. Users rarely measure latency, but they always feel it. Tell us where your app’s patience runs thin—and where it delights.
Consistency Beats Occasional Bursts
A single snappy screen cannot compensate for a stuttering feed or laggy checkout. Consistent responsiveness across flows builds trust. Which part of your journey needs smoothing to make the whole experience shine?
Anecdote From a Small Team
A three-person startup trimmed their onboarding from eight to three seconds by deferring analytics initialization. Activation rose quietly, support tickets fell, and reviews mentioned “surprisingly quick.” What one change could unlock your similar win?

Startup Times: Cold, Warm, and Resume

Cold start dominates first impressions. Measure p50 and p95 to catch real-world spikes, and separate warm starts to avoid masking regressions. Ask your team weekly: did we get faster where it counts most?

Smoothness: FPS, Jank, and Frame Deadlines

Humans feel stutter before they see it. Track dropped frames and long frames exceeding your platform deadline. Aim for steady frame pacing, not just peak FPS. Which screen janks most on lower-end devices?

Reliability: ANR, Crash-Free Sessions, and Latency Budgets

Crashes and ANRs erase trust faster than any optimization can restore it. Pair crash-free session rate with strict latency budgets for critical taps. What’s your current p95 tap-to-action time in production?

Launch Fast: Strategies to Reduce Time-to-First-Interaction

Defer Non-Critical Work

Move logging, feature flag refreshes, and prefetching off the critical path. Initialize lazily after the first screen is interactive. A smaller main thread footprint typically yields dramatic, user-visible improvements within days.

Trim Dependency Graphs

Large dependency graphs slow startup silently. Remove unused modules, compile-time wire where possible, and prefer lightweight providers. Measure before and after with precise timestamps to prove wins to your stakeholders convincingly.

Design a Purposeful First Screen

Show something useful immediately: recent content, saved state, or a simple entry point. Optimize layout for minimal overdraw and quick rendering. Ask users: did the app feel ready before you started thinking?

Rendering and Navigation: Keeping Transitions Fluid

Use recycling or virtualization, stable item keys, and predictable cell sizes. Avoid expensive bindings in hot paths. Pre-calculate layouts when possible, and paginate gently. Which feed or catalog page hurts most today?

Rendering and Navigation: Keeping Transitions Fluid

Flatten view hierarchies, use opaque backgrounds strategically, and avoid unnecessary layout passes. Cache computed sizes. Small visual tweaks compound into large wins when multiplied across frequently visited screens and transitions.

Networking, Caching, and Offline: Winning the Real-World

Adopt pagination, delta updates, and compact formats. Prefer modern image codecs like WebP or AVIF where supported. Measure p95 payload size over time to prevent slow, silent regressions that frustrate travelers.

Networking, Caching, and Offline: Winning the Real-World

Define TTLs per resource, validate with ETags, and store last-known-good responses for offline continuity. Make stale-while-revalidate the default for non-critical content. Users value continuity far more than perfect recency.

Skeletons and Shimmer Done Right

Mirror the final layout with skeletons, avoid jitter, and fade content in smoothly. Instant structure reduces uncertainty. Keep placeholders lightweight to ensure they never become yet another source of lag.

Prioritize Above-the-Fold and Critical Actions

Load essential content first, defer secondary modules, and prewarm crucial resources. Let users act quickly, even while non-critical pieces load. This focus communicates respect and competence from the very first second.

Microcopy That Calms and Guides

Swap vague spinners for honest, encouraging messages: what’s happening, what’s next, and how long. Friendly clarity reduces drop-offs. What one line of microcopy could make your slowest moment feel kinder today?
Waupacacampingpark
Privacy Overview

This website uses cookies so that we can provide you with the best user experience possible. Cookie information is stored in your browser and performs functions such as recognising you when you return to our website and helping our team to understand which sections of the website you find most interesting and useful.